About This Coffee

This is a decaf espresso coffee from Musenyi, Burundi, grown at 1550-1650 meters altitude. Processed using DCM DECAF method, it is made from Bourbon variety beans cultivated by small local producers. The coffee presents tasting notes of lemon cookie, almond, and anise. COSDAR cooperative, founded by agronomist Néstor, manages the Musenyi washing station near the Tanzania border, which operates on solar energy. Recommended for espresso and Italian moka brewing methods.

Dalston Coffee

Borja Rosello, a former chef, founded Dalston Coffee in 2017 in Barcelona's Raval neighborhood. The name comes from the Dalston district in East London where Borja worked and first discovered specialty coffee after tasting a flat white that struck him as an entirely different kind of drink. The roastery operates from a separate facility in La Garriga outside Barcelona, supplying the shop alongside coffees from guest roasters like Five Elephant and Koppi. Equipment runs La Marzocco espresso and Mahlkonig grinders. The packaging, redesigned six years after opening with illustrator Lourenco Providencia, depicts each product as a single house, with the full range forming a colorful neighborhood. The space itself is small and plant filled, built around good music and an informal atmosphere.
